Dining Hall
Chattanooga, TN
(with TVS Interiors)
CLIENT:
McCallie School
COMPLETION:
2004
SIZE:
31,000 sq. ft.

DESCRIPTION:
The dining hall is sited among the various dormitory buildings housing the majority of the McCallie student population. The colonial Georgian detailing blends with the rest of this Neoclassical boarding school campus. The facility seats up to 390 students in the main dining hall. The kitchen and serving area produces three meals per day. The serving area is a “scramble” type server, with different food stations spread out in a 3,700 sq. ft. area. The 6,700 sq. ft. kitchen prepares all in-dining meals and also provides campus-wide catering services.

A separate headmaster dining room serves over 20 guests. Additionally a large, dividable meeting room can seat about 140 for dinner and about 160 for a presentation.
